The Early History of Egypt is a historical book written by Samuel Sharpe in 1836. The book provides a comprehensive overview of the early history of Egypt, drawing from various sources such as the Old Testament, Herodotus, Manetho, and hieroglyphical inscriptions. The book is divided into several chapters, each of which covers a specific period in Egypt's early history. Sharpe begins by discussing the creation myths and the early dynasties of Egypt, including the legendary kings Menes and Narmer. He then moves on to the Old Kingdom, discussing the reigns of famous pharaohs such as Khufu and Menkaure, and the construction of the pyramids.Sharpe also covers the Middle Kingdom, which saw the rise of powerful pharaohs such as Amenemhet I and Senusret III, as well as the Hyksos invasion that led to the downfall of the Middle Kingdom. He then discusses the New Kingdom, which saw the reigns of famous pharaohs such as Hatshepsut, Thutmose III, and Akhenaten, and the construction of the great temples at Karnak and Luxor.Throughout the book, Sharpe provides detailed descriptions of the hieroglyphical inscriptions found on ancient Egyptian monuments and tombs, and he also discusses the work of early Egyptologists such as Champollion and Rosellini.
